The Securities and Exchange Commission of Ghana issues these guidelines to establish comprehensive licensing, operational, and governance standards for private funds, including hedge, private equity, and venture capital vehicles. The framework mandates that funds appoint licensed managers and independent custodians while maintaining a minimum fund size of ten million Ghana Cedis and ensuring at least one independent director on the board. It further enforces strict fit-and-proper criteria, mandatory custody and valuation policies, annual audits, and public offer restrictions to safeguard qualified investors and ensure regulatory compliance.
